Nau mai, haere mai!


Welcome to Te Papa New Zealands national museum.

The Map, OurSpace

Awesome Forces
Experience the powerful geological forces that have shaped New Zealands landscape and natural life and get a real shake-up in the Earthquake House! Level 2.

Mountains to Sea
Sample New Zealands stunningly diverse animal and plant life, and gasp at Te Papas famous colossal squid the only complete specimen youll see anywhere in the world. Level 2.

Mana Whenua
Experience the richness and complexity of Mori culture through a powerful mix of ancestral treasures and contemporary art. Level 4.
Waka huia (treasure box), 15001800, maker unknown, wood. Te Papa (OL000003)

Our name literally means container of treasures. Here at Te Papa, youll discover the treasures and stories of New Zealands land and people, told with authority and passion. The Museum is built on a unique bicultural partnership, which recognises and celebrates Mori as tangata whenua the original people of this land. Our collections are spread over six oors of engaging, interactive displays. Youll encounter Mori and Pacic cultural treasures, New Zealands extraordinary natural life, its most important works of art, and its unique history. This is Our Place. Enjoy your visit.
